基於Bootstrap和Knockout.js的ASP.NET MVC開發實戰


之前在一家公司里用過Knockout,是easyui 和 Knockout結合 的。下面的這本應該不錯。

 

目錄

前言 
第一部分入門指南 
第1章MVC介紹 
創建第一個項目 
分析HomeController 
分析View 
理解URL結構 
小結 
第2章Bootstrap介紹 
默認菜單 
含有下拉列表和搜索框的菜單 
按鈕 
警告框 
主題 
小結 
第3章Knockout.js介紹 
安裝Knockout.js 
基本示例 
何為MVVM? 
創建ViewModel 
小結 
第4章數據庫應用 
Entity Framework介紹 
Code First 
Database First 
創建測試數據 
小結 
第二部分數據處理 
第5章表的查詢、排序、分頁 
Author查詢 
Author排序 
Author分頁 
小結 
第6章表單處理 
在表單中集成Knockout 
共享View和ViewModel 
在模態框中進行刪除操作 
空表格 
小結 
第7章服務器端ViewModel 
為什么要創建服務器端ViewModel? 
AuthorViewModel 
更新Authors列表 
更新Add/Edit表單 
更新Delete模態框 
小結 
第8章Web API介紹 
安裝Web API 
更新Authors列表 
更新Authors的Add/Edit表單 
小結 
第三部分代碼架構 
第9章創建全局過濾器 
Authentication過濾器 
Authorization過濾器 
Action過濾器 
Result過濾器 
Exception過濾器 
Web API全局驗證 
用Result過濾器進行自動映射 
Web API錯誤處理 
MVC錯誤處理 
小結 
第10章添加驗證與授權 
Authentication概述 
Authorization概述 
實現一個Authentication過濾器 
實現一個Authorization過濾器 
小結 
第11章使用Attribute定義URL路由 
Attribute路由基礎知識 
路由前綴 
路由約束 
小結 
第12章胖模型、瘦控制器 
關注點分離 
服務與行為 
小結 
第四部分應用實例 
第13章構建購物車 
購物車需求 
購物車項目 
JavaScript捆綁與最小化 
小結 
第14章構建數據模型 
Code—First模型 
定義DbContext並初始化數據 
視圖模型 
小結 
第15章布局實現 
共享布局 
購物車摘要 
分類菜單 
小結 
第16章圖書列表 
主頁 
特色圖書 
按分類篩選圖書 
小結 
第17章添加購物車 
圖書詳情 
自定義組件和自定義綁定 
保存購物車項 
小結 
第18章更新或刪除購物車 
購物車詳情 
購物車詳情上的Knockout應用 
完成購物車 
小結

 我找到了它的英文版鏈接:

http://download.csdn.net/detail/aidenchan/9424788

這邊書的示列:

bootstrapintroduction.zip

shoppingcart.zip

 


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M